184. Stereoselective Hydrolysis of Substituted Cyclopropanedicarboxylates with Pig Liver Esterase
Walser, Paula,Renold, Peter,N'Goka, Victor,Hosseinzadeh, Fatemeh,Tamm, Christoph
, p. 1941 - 1952 (2007/10/02)
The hydrolysis of the meso-cyclopropane-1,2-dicarboxylates 1a-3a, 4, 5a, 6a, and 9, containing various substituents at C(3), and of the rac-3-phenylcyclopropane-1,2-dicarboxylates 7a, 8a, and 10 with pig liver esterase (PLE) is described.The stereoselectivity and absolute configurations of the products were determined.An interpretation of results was attempted on the basis of a recent active-site model for PLE.
